Hearts and teddy bears might have a girlie connotation, but these designers definitely put a grown-up spin on them.
Exhibitionist
Earrings in 18-karat gold with pink tourmaline.
I love these earrings because the pink hearts make them sweet while the flames make them spicy. I think these stud earrings would be a great accent to a bold gold necklace and some stacked bangles for a casual, fun look.
These earrings are actually pretty tame for Exhibitionist designer Michael Spirito, who specializes in tattoo-inspired jewelry laden with skulls and bones.
Suggested retail price is $550.
